npm 包 @cypress/eslint-plugin-dev 使用教程

阅读时长 3 分钟读完

在前端开发中,代码质量是非常重要的事情。代码质量不好会影响代码的可读性,维护性以及将来的拓展性等等问题。因此,开发者们需要利用各种工具来提高代码的质量。其中一个非常重要的工具就是 eslint,它可以帮助开发者轻松地检查代码中的潜在问题。

在本文中,我们将介绍 npm 包 @cypress/eslint-plugin-dev 的使用教程,它能够让我们更加轻松地使用 eslint,同时还能为我们提供更多的检查功能。

安装

我们可以通过 npm 来安装 @cypress/eslint-plugin-dev,我们只需要运行下面的命令即可:

配置

安装完成之后,我们需要在 eslint 的配置文件中添加 @cypress/eslint-plugin-dev。假设我们的 eslint 配置文件是 .eslintrc.json,那我们可以通过下面的方式来添加:

这里的 @cypress/eslint-plugin-dev/rule-name 表示我们需要启用的规则的名称,可以在该插件的文档中查看所有可用的规则。

使用

安装和配置完成之后,我们就可以开始使用 @cypress/eslint-plugin-dev 了。这里,我们来看一个具体的例子:

在这个例子中,我们定义了一个加法函数。接下来,我们可以在一个测试文件中使用该函数进行测试:

在这个测试文件中,我们使用了 @cypress/eslint-plugin-dev 定义的一个规则:no-only-tests。这个规则会检查是否使用了 mocha 中的 .only 函数来标记一个单独的测试执行。因为将单独的测试执行筛选出来可能会导致我们忽略其他的测试,所以这个规则默认是禁用的。

但是,在这个测试文件中,我们明确地标记了只执行一个测试,因此该规则将会抛出一个错误。

总结

通过本文,我们了解了 @cypress/eslint-plugin-dev 的安装和配置方法,同时也了解了该插件的一个具体例子。希望该插件能够帮助开发者们更加轻松地检查代码,并提高代码的质量。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/5eedad1fb5cbfe1ea0610be1

纠错
反馈